NASS Backs MATAN Initiative, Pledges Legislative Support For Nationwide Food Security

In a powerful address delivered on behalf of Rt. Hon. Tajudeen Abas, Speaker of the House of Representatives, during the closing ceremony of the three‑day MATAN Food Bank Professionals Association of Nigeria event at the National Institute of Sports Gymnasium Hall, Surulere, Hon. Haruna Gowon underscored that food security is the cornerstone of national stability, second only to health in importance.

Representing Bassa/Dekina Federal Constituency under the APC, Rep. Gowon declared that without reliable access to food, no other security measure can succeed. “Food security promotes physical and mental health, reduces health risks, supports development, prevents malnutrition, increases productivity, alleviates poverty, drives social stability, and strengthens environmental resilience,” he said, emphasising that the issue touches every facet of nation‑building.

He warned that economic distortions such as currency volatility are fuelled by hunger, noting, “When food security is available, the value of the naira against the dollar will naturally drop. A hungry man is an angry man, and food insecurity fuels insecurity across the country, making travel unsafe and feeding every negative force.”

Gowon called on all stakeholders to rally behind MATAN’s mission, pledging that the National Assembly will enact supportive legislation to remove obstacles and accelerate implementation. “We at the NASS will back you with laws that make food security a national priority. No matter the challenge, the House stands behind you, ready to translate your constituents’ calls into actionable policies,” he affirmed.

He highlighted the legislative agenda, indicating plans to introduce bills that eliminate multiple taxation, streamline food distribution logistics, and incentivise private-sector participation in community food banks and street kitchens. The lawmaker also urged state and local governments to align their programmes with MATAN’s framework for maximum impact.

Gowon concluded with a rallying cry: “Put all effort into this, and together we will tame the forces threatening our nation. Food security is not just a policy—it is the foundation for peace, prosperity, and progress.”

The event, which also featured the launch of MATAN’s Automated Food Security Initiative and digital ID system, drew legislators, traditional leaders, and development partners, all echoing the lawmaker’s call for collective action to end hunger and foster national resilience.
